With an accuracy of up to 0.02% of full scale and pressure ranges extending from -1 bar to 1000 bar, the APGK Series is designed to meet the demanding requirements of industrial pressure calibration in both laboratory and field environments. The instrument supports 14 selectable pressure units and includes a clear display with a 0–100% full-scale progress bar, enabling technicians to easily monitor pressure levels during testing.
Available as a standalone digital gauge or as part of pneumatic (-0.95 to 35 bar) and hydraulic (up to 700 bar) test kits, the APGK Series offers flexibility for a wide variety of pressure calibration tasks. Built with a rugged IP67 protection class, the device is suitable for harsh industrial environments while maintaining reliable performance. Additional functions such as zero, tare, and peak hold enhance usability by allowing quick setup and accurate capture of pressure variations. Combining precision measurement with versatile pressure generation capability, the APGK Series provides an efficient and comprehensive solution for calibrating pressure gauges, transducers, and other pressure instruments.
